French war hero Charles Nungesser and his navigator François Coli vanished during their attempt to make the first transatlantic flight from Paris to New York, leaving behind one of aviation’s greatest mysteries.

Charles Lindbergh was a national hero—but though his aviation accomplishments cemented his celebrity, his legacy remains scandalous.
